* refactor: active speakers
1. Observe the loudest adjusted with active ratio instead of linear average of decibel values
2. Follow RFC6465 to convert audio level from decibel to linear value.
3. Quantize audio level for stable slice comparison
4. Switch moving average algorithm from MMA to EMA to have the same center of mass with SMA
5. Minor: remove seenSids map allocation
6. Minor: minimize division arithmetic
